Frequently asked questions about holiday rentals in Canada

  • What are the must-see places in Canada?

    Choosing just a few is tough, but Banff National Park in the Rockies is breathtaking, with its turquoise lakes and towering mountains. Niagara Falls is an iconic spectacle, and exploring the historic streets of Quebec City feels like stepping back in time. For a vibrant city experience, Toronto offers everything from the CN Tower to diverse neighbourhoods. Vancouver's stunning natural setting, combined with its cosmopolitan feel, is another must-see.

  • What are the typical activities to do in Canada?

    Canada offers diverse activities. Hiking and camping are popular in national parks like Banff and Jasper. Whale watching tours are available off the coasts of British Columbia and Newfoundland. Skiing and snowboarding are hugely popular in the Rockies and other mountainous regions during winter. In cities, exploring museums, art galleries, and diverse culinary scenes are common activities.

  • Which part of Canada offers the most pleasant climate?

    This depends on your preference. For warm summers and mild winters, consider the Okanagan Valley in British Columbia. Victoria, on Vancouver Island, also enjoys a relatively temperate climate. However, Canada's climate varies significantly across regions, so specifying your ideal temperature range will help determine the best location for you.

  • What airport options are there for reaching Canada?

    Major international airports include Toronto Pearson International Airport (YYZ), Vancouver International Airport (YVR), Montreal–Trudeau International Airport (YUL), and Calgary International Airport (YYC). Many smaller airports serve regional destinations across the country.

  • Are there specific challenges to driving in Canada that visitors should know?

    Driving distances can be vast, especially in the western provinces. Winter conditions, particularly in the mountainous regions, can be challenging, requiring winter tires and careful driving. Be aware of wildlife crossing the roads, especially at dawn and dusk. Familiarising yourself with Canadian traffic laws is essential.

  • What currency is used in Canada?

    The Canadian dollar (CAD) is the official currency.
  • What are the top festivals to experience in Canada?

    Canada Day celebrations (1st July) are nationwide. The Calgary Stampede (July) is a massive rodeo and exhibition. The Montreal International Jazz Festival (June/July) is a world-renowned event. Numerous smaller festivals take place across the country throughout the year, celebrating diverse cultures and traditions.
  • What is the best time of year to visit Canada?

    The best time depends on your interests. Summer (June-August) offers warm weather ideal for hiking and outdoor activities. Autumn (September-October) provides stunning foliage. Winter (December-February) is perfect for skiing and snowboarding, while spring (March-May) offers milder temperatures and blooming flowers.
  • What are some local dishes to try in Canada?

    Poutine (fries, cheese curds, and gravy) is a classic. Nanaimo bars are a popular dessert. Butter tarts are a sweet treat. Lobster rolls are a delicacy in Atlantic Canada. The diverse culinary scene offers many regional specialties.
  • What emergency numbers should you know in case of a medical or security issue in Canada?

    Dial 911 for police, fire, or ambulance emergencies.
  • What etiquette tips are important when visiting Canada?

    Canadians are generally polite and reserved. Saying 'please' and 'thank you' is appreciated. Tipping in restaurants is customary (around 15-20%). Being mindful of personal space is also important.
  • What are the best areas to spend a week in Canada?

    A week allows for exploring a region in depth. Consider the Canadian Rockies (Banff and Jasper), exploring the Pacific Coast of British Columbia (Vancouver and Victoria), or a road trip through the Maritimes (Nova Scotia, New Brunswick, and Prince Edward Island).
  • What are the best areas to spend a weekend in Canada?

    For a weekend getaway, a city like Toronto, Montreal, or Quebec City offers plenty to see and do. Niagara Falls is also easily accessible for a short trip. Consider exploring a nearby national park or scenic area depending on your location.
  • What are the top shopping destinations in Canada?

    Toronto's Eaton Centre is a large shopping mall. Vancouver's Robson Street offers high-end boutiques. Montreal's underground city provides extensive shopping options. Many cities have unique local boutiques and markets.
  • What are some off-the-beaten-path places to explore in Canada?

    Gros Morne National Park in Newfoundland offers dramatic landscapes. The Bay of Fundy in Nova Scotia is known for its extreme tides. Churchill, Manitoba, offers opportunities to see polar bears. These are just a few examples of the many less-visited but equally rewarding destinations.
